* What you’ll be doing

* We are looking for motivated representatives ready to help Canadians from coast to coast.

As an

* Information Officer*, you will deliver a first-class caller experience as a representative of the

* Federal Government of Canada*.

Information Officers are responsible for delivering quality information to citizens on government programs, services and initiatives, and guiding Canadians on how to access them.

* Answer inbound and Outbound telephone enquiries on federal programs and services

* Deliver a first class caller experience as a representative of the federal government

* Educate callers about federal programs and services available to them

* Keep up to date on the information in the database

* Meet qualitative and quantitative targets

* Develop knowledge of the Canadian government and its structure

* Attend meetings on procedures and other work-related subjects
